Summary- As a member of the Global Capital Sourcing team, a Senior Contracts & Claims Manager is sought to be responsible for the commercial management of a variety of projects within large and medium green or brown field CAPEX schemes (CAPEX project sizes/spend of min 5 m USD). The aims are to protect client's rights and entitlements as provided in the contracts, ensure the Contractors' obligations are fulfilled, ensure client is fulfilling their obligations, optimizing value-for-money, reducing contract risks, lowest Total Cost of Ownership (TCO), on time/schedule delivery, quality and in-cost project purchases to support the goal for client's growth investments.
- He/she is in position to mitigate risks related to the contract creation / execution, identify cost benefit solutions to complex contractual matters (including regular delivery and close out of complex negotiations with extremal Stakeholders and Consultants).
- The position is expected to act as a commercial expert working in close cooperation and coordination together with the Global Engineering team (SGIE), the local project team and any other relevant internal or external stakeholder, ensuring a common Client approach to suppliers.

- Support the definition of the Risk mitigation plan;
- Participate in development of contracting strategies;
- Involve Cost Control Group and ensure the implementation of cost control system e.g. progress measurement, remeasurement, bank guarantees, additional items, claims, cash flow and back-charges;
- Analyse the contract conditions and assist the project management in the preparation and conduction of the execution of those contracts;
- Involvement with the review of new tenders and contracts with Strategic Supplier;
- Support the negotiation of major contracts, subcontracts and own the final review and document preparation with Strategic Supplier;
- Ensure relevant Procurement & SGIE process and standards are followed.
- Lead the execution of contracts to secure our client contractual rights and entitlements;
- Responsible to report contracting plan status and variations to the Project & Procurement on a periodic basis;
- Manage the contracting plan during project execution, commissioning and evaluation stages, including the contractor's cost in cooperation with Cost Control;
- Prepare a summary of key contractual points (deviations from norms, identified risks, of concern to client) generated by a review such that they can be readily identified and addressed;
- Negotiate and agree contract extensions & change request;
- Coordinate activities such as change orders, delay management, conflict management, preparation for potential litigation / arbitration / ADR in terms of proper documentation, timely responses to the contractor as per contract;
- Monitor and safeguards the legal right as per the provisions of the contract;
- Manage the Warranty and performance guarantees of the project assets;
- Ensuring all requirements of client, are met with respect to contract review;
- Coordinating the involvement of legal counsel and/or Client legal counsel in reviews as required;
- Support in Arbitration and in Alternative Dispute Resolution Procedures;
- Overseeing, managing, directing and supporting the project commercial teams to ensure optimization of project returns.
- Identifying opportunities for outgoing claims, development of claim strategies, supporting/preparing notifications/correspondence as well as negotiation and settlement;
- Analysis of incoming claims, development of defense strategies, supporting/preparing response/correspondence, claim negotiation and settlement;
- Collection and registration of all claim related documentation in company's claim repository.
- Manage escalation of issues and claims management with supplier;
- Develop the supplier relationship according to the expectations per supplier segment;
- Support supplier relationship management and to ensure reliable high quality supply;
- Support the supplier performance, compliance and accountability through supplier scorecards and performance metrics;
- Involved in periodic commercial audits of main contractors.
- Identify and engage with internal stakeholders, including Project Management, Global SGIE, Global Procurement and Corporate Functions (mainly Legal and Finance);
- Clarify stakeholder requirements;
- Drive proactive communications.
